Gold Rate Today, December 5: Gold prices remained flat on Friday, as traders await rate cut decision by the US Federal Reserve next week. In Mumbai, the price of 24-carat gold stood at Rs 1,29,650 per 10 grams, while 22k gold was available at Rs 1,18,850 per 10 grams. These rates do not include GST and making charges. Silver was available at Rs 1,90,900 per kg in the spot market.
On the MCX, gold inched down marginally by 0.16% to trade at Rs 1,29,870 per 10 grams for the February 5 contracts, whereas silver was trading slightly higher by 0.70% to trade at Rs 1,79,381 per kg in the futures market in the morning trade.

Rahul Kalantri, vice-president (commodities) at Mehta Equities, said, “Gold firmed while silver dipped on Thursday after positive U.S. jobless claims data. Silver saw mild profit-booking from short-term futures traders as part of a routine pullback within its broader uptrend, ahead of the September PCE data, which is expected to shape expectations for monetary easing. Weak labour market indicators — including a sharper-than-expected drop in ADP payrolls and elevated layoffs — increased the likelihood of a rate cut at the upcoming FOMC meeting, with market odds now nearing 87%. A stronger rupee also exerted additional pressure on precious metals.”
What Factors Affect Gold Prices In India?
International market rates, import duties, taxes, and fluctuations in exchange rates primarily influence gold prices in India. Together, these factors determine the daily gold rates across the country.
In India, gold is deeply cultural and financial. It is a preferred investment option and is key to celebrations, particularly weddings and festivals.
